Colonial Park Mall, Harrisburg PA - As Dead As A Mall Can Die

I've posted images from this dead mall before, but this is the saddest I've ever seen it. There was, at most, 10 people here, and that includes workers and employees. A look down Colonial Park Mall (Harrisburg PA)

I wanted to get more pictures but this was sadly the only one I took, down the lane is a cross with a boscovs in front of an old fountain on one side and a dead end of nothing on the other. Straight ahead is the food court which has some really old looking logos for some places.
